Neuro-linguistic programming (NLP) is a set of techniques and principles that aim to improve communication, behavior and personal development. It was developed in the 1970s by Richard Bandler and John Grinder, who claimed to model the skills of successful therapists and communicators. NLP has been widely applied in various fields such as education, business, coaching, sports, and health.

NLP is based on the assumption that human experience is subjective and can be changed by altering the way we perceive, think, and express ourselves. NLP practitioners use various methods to help clients achieve their goals, such as rapport building, reframing, anchoring, modeling, and meta-programs. NLP also draws on concepts from linguistics, psychology, hypnosis, and neurology.
